One of the key functions of AZS stirring rods is to prevent glass from solidifying and promote uniform flow. In a glass melting furnace, glass tends to solidify at certain points, which can cause uneven thickness and quality issues in the final products. By using AZS stirring rods, the glass can maintain a fluid state, and its flow becomes more uniform. AZS stirring rods are also known for their excellent corrosion and erosion resistance and low pollution characteristics. In the harsh environment of glass production, equipment is often corroded by high - temperature glass and various chemical substances. Traditional stirring rods may need to be replaced frequently, which increases the production cost. AZS stirring rods, on the other hand, can withstand the corrosion and erosion of glass and chemicals for a long time. This reduces the frequency of equipment replacement and maintenance, thereby helping enterprises save a lot of costs. The high refractoriness, good thermal stability, and excellent anti - spalling performance of AZS stirring rods ensure the stable operation of equipment. In high - temperature glass production processes, the stirring rods need to withstand extreme temperatures and thermal shocks. The high refractoriness of AZS stirring rods allows them to maintain their shape and performance at high temperatures, while their thermal stability and anti - spalling performance prevent them from cracking or peeling off, ensuring the continuous and stable operation of the production line.
